WebAs the #1 manufacturer in the world China now produces nearly $2.5 trillion of goods. While this is around 28% greater than the U.S., manufacturing makes up an astounding 30.5% of China’s GDP vs. 12.3% for the U.S. One thing experts acknowledge is at $2 trillion in manufactured output the U.S. produces more with less labor.
